Gionee's new smartphone F103 Pro launched; India gets first look

Chinese smartphone manufacturer Gionee has launched its latest device F103 Pro in India for customers who seek stylish phones with powerful performance. Gionee F103 The device has 5-inch water-drop glass display and 4G VoLTE support.   The device has 3GB RAM and 16GB on board memory (expandable up to 128GB) with a 2,400 mAh battery. Gionee F103 Pro comes with 13MP rear camera and a 5MP selfie camera with advanced features like face beauty, text recognition, an expanded network choice, Desktop editor, Gionee-abroad services, Trash feature and Time Lapse. The device is available in three colours -- white, gold and grey. Some of Gionee F103 Pro's specs  The F103 is available for Rs 11,999 on Flipkart. Yahoo Mail announces new updates for iOS, Android

Yahoo Mail on Thursday introduced several new updates for iOS and Android operating platforms that are focused on allowing users to add personal touch to their inbox. Yahoo now allows iOS users to take back an email right after it’s been sent. After you press send, an option to “undo” will appear at the bottom of your inbox feed for three seconds. Just click that and you’ll stop the email from sending. Using "Xobni" technology, Yahoo will now give iOS users options to search for a person in mail, the company said in a statement. In addition to their most recent emails, you’ll also be able to see their contact card with information including picture, phone number and email history. For Android users, Yahoo has introduced the Stationery feature that allows you to add an extra touch to your emails, making that birthday wish to your best friend or thank you letter to Grandma that much more special. Samsung launches new phones: Galaxy J2 and Galaxy J Max

Leading smartphone manufacturer Samsung on Friday launched two new Galaxy series phones with two new specs Turbo Speed Technology (TST) and Smart Glow technologies. Newly-launched Galaxy J2 2016 is the refreshed version of Galaxy J2 launched in 2015, an addition to Samsung's existing 4G enabled smartphone portfolio. The re engineered Galaxy J2 2016 is equipped with TST, a new technology which delivers superior performance by loading native apps 40 per cent faster. Available in Gold, Black, and White color options, the Galaxy J2 (2016) measures 142.4 x 71.1 x 8.0mm. The device runs on Android Marshmallow. The Samsung Galaxy J2 The handset also features Turbo Speed Technology (TST) that is aimed at performance enhancement, which is achieved by "using the least amount of resources to complete a particular task in the fastest time."
